 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Augmenting Research and Educational Sites to Ensure Agriculture Remains Cutting-Edge and Helpful Act or the AG RESEARCH Act

This bill provides funding for maintenance at agricultural research facilities.

The Department of Agriculture (USDA) must (1) revise its review process for evaluating proposals for agricultural research facilities to include consulting with representatives of the National Institute of Food and Agriculture (NIFA) peer review panels; and (2) establish a grant program within NIFA to provide agricultural research facilities with a federal share of the cost for the construction, alteration, acquisition, modernization, renovation, or remodeling of the research facilities or the equipment necessary for agricultural research.

Additionally, the bill provides funding for the grant program and for USDA to provide direct payments to research facilities of the Agricultural Research Service for addressing deferred maintenance. USDA must give priority to the most critical structures in accordance with the Agricultural Research Service Capital Investment Strategy (April 2012).
